Account Exec | Base £40k-£70k (Y1 OTE £100k-£110k) | London
We're working with a fast-growth cyber business flipping the insurance industry on its head and they’re looking for high-performing sales talent to join them.
The Opportunity
This specialist brokerage is Europe’s sole cyber-only player, backed by serious funding and targeting an IPO by 2028. They have the runway, market opportunity and financial backing to change an entire industry and generate life-changing levels of remuneration for those involved.
A full-cycle, sales position where you’ll build your own pipeline, develop opportunities through a consultative process, and retain clients long-term to create a compounding book of business. Success comes from consistent outbound activity, strong deal ownership, and proactive relationship management post-sale.

What You’ll Be Doing
- Generating new business through proactive outreach to senior decision-makers
- Developing and closing opportunities via a consultative sales process
- Managing and growing your portfolio post-sale, leading onboarding and renewals
- Leveraging internal cyber and insurance specialists to win and retain clients
Earning Potential & Perks
- Uncapped commission structure (ability to compound your earnings YOY with retention of all accounts - heavily renewals based industry)
- OTE: Y1 - £100k-£110k, Y2 - £140k-£160k, Y3 - £180k-£220k
- Top performer benchmarks: £180k (Y1), £300k (top performer)
- Equity upside for top performers aligned to IPO trajectory
- Regular revenue incentives (Michelin-star lunches, annual incentive trips - Ibiza in 2025)
- Private healthcare
- Structured onboarding with hands-on development and coaching

Who They’re Looking For
Insurance experience isn’t required — mindset is everything. You’ll likely thrive if you're:
- Competitive, ambitious, and resilient
- Pride yourself on your work ethic
- Inquisitive with a strong desire to improve
- Hate losing, but never a sore loser
- Comfortable with direct feedback in a high-performance environment
- Commercially minded with interest in business, tech or global economics
- Motivated to build something meaningful rather than just hit a number
Why Join?
You’ll enter a scaling, specialist market at the right time, with real ownership, equity potential and the chance to create long-term wealth from a portfolio you build and retain.
